Could a lack of testosterone or a thyroid deficiency lead to a drop in libido?

Dr. Roscoe Nelson, UC San Diego School of Medicine Answered Aug. 18, 2012
26 years experience in Urology
Yes. As can obesity, lack of sleep, stress etc.
